Three Solutions to Put Yourself into a Video Using FlexClip

Solution 1: Layer Yourself to the Background Video with Video Settings

This method works best when the two videos share the same or similar backgrounds, as it eliminates the need for additional steps to address contrasting backdrops. If this applies to your situation, follow the steps below to seamlessly superimpose yourself into the video.

Step 1
Open FlexClip in your browser and upload both the background video and your recorded video under the Media panel. FlexClip allows you to import resources from your computer, mobile device, or third-party storage platforms like Google Drive.

Step 2
Add the background video to the timeline. Then, click Add As Layer to insert the clip featuring yourself as a picture-in-picture (PIP) layer. Once added, resize and reposition the layer as desired.

Step 3
Click on the Opacity option and adjust the slider to ensure you blend naturally into the background video. For even better results, navigate to Opacity > Blend Mode and select the most suitable mode to make yourself appear as part of the background video.

Solution 2: Put Yourself into Video with Green Screen

With a green or solid-colored backdrop, you can seamlessly overlay yourself into a video using FlexClip’s green screen feature. The tool uses color contrast to isolate the subject from the background, so be sure to avoid wearing clothes that match or closely resemble the backdrop color. Import Your Videos

Start by importing both the background video and the green screen video into FlexClip. Drag and drop the background clip onto the timeline, then add the green screen video as a picture-in-picture layer.

Remove the Green Screen Backdrop

To seamlessly place yourself into the background video, navigate to the Green Screen tool and use the color picker to remove the green screen backdrop. Adjust the Intensity slider to achieve the best green removal effect.

Customize Your Placement and Appearance

Once the green screen is removed, you can freely position yourself (now with a transparent background) anywhere in the video. Adjust the opacity and blend mode to create a natural and visually appealing result, making it appear as though you were part of the original video all along.

    1.How to put yourself in a video using CapCut?

    CapCut, a versatile video editing tool, provides multiple features to help you overlay yourself into a video, such as Green Screen, video overlay, and more. Here we’ll walk you through the process using the Green Screen feature as an example.

    Step 1: Download CapCut to your computer, mobile and other devices and complete installation. Record yourself with a green screen or other solid color background for easy editing.

    Step 2: Open CapCut and tap Create a New Project to import the background video that you’ll insert yourself into.

    Step 3: Tap Overlay > Add Overlay and select your recorded green screen video. Then use the Color Picker to select the green background and adjust the strength and shadow sliders to remove the green screen completely

    Step 4: Once the green screen is removed, resize and position yourself anywhere in the video and use CapCut’s editing tools to make further adjustments, such as trimming, adding effects, or enhancing the overall look.
